1. Moneyline Bets


One of the most straightforward and popular betting types is the moneyline bet. In a moneyline bet, you simply choose the team or player you believe will win the event. For example, in a football game, you would bet on either the home team or the away team to win. The odds for a moneyline bet are usually presented as either a positive or negative number. A negative number indicates the favorite (e.g., -150), meaning you need to bet $150 to win $100. A positive number (e.g., +120) represents the underdog, where a $100 bet would earn you $120 in profit if successful.

Moneyline bets are great for beginners, as they are easy to understand and don’t require complex strategies.

2. Point Spread Bets


Point spread betting is another popular type, especially in sports like football and basketball. This type of bet involves betting on the margin of victory. The sportsbook will set a point spread, which is a handicap given to the underdog, and you bet on whether the favorite will win by more than the spread or whether the underdog will “cover the spread” by losing by less than the set number.

For example, if the point spread for a basketball game is set at Lakers -5 against the Celtics +5, the Lakers must win by more than five points for a bet on them to win. If the Celtics lose by four points or less, or win the game, a bet on them would win.

Point spread betting is ideal for those who enjoy analyzing matchups and predicting how closely contested an event will be.

3. Over/Under (Total) Bets


The over/under bet is based on predicting the total combined score of both teams in a match, not just the winner. For example, in a soccer game, JILIBET might set a line of 2.5 goals for the over/under. You would then bet on whether the total number of goals scored will be over or under that line.

If the total score is 3 or more, the "over" bet wins. If it's 2 or fewer, the "under" bet wins. This type of bet is particularly popular in high-scoring games like football, basketball, or hockey, and it gives bettors a chance to wager on the total performance of both teams rather than just the outcome.

4. Parlay Bets


A parlay bet combines multiple individual bets into one larger wager. In order for a parlay to win, all of the bets (legs) within it must be successful. Parlays offer higher payouts because they are riskier; the more bets you include, the harder it becomes to win, but the potential payout increases.

For example, you might place a parlay with three different bets: one on a football game, one on a basketball game, and one on a tennis match. If all three of your selected teams or players win, you’ll receive a payout that combines the odds of each individual bet. However, if one leg loses, the entire parlay is lost.

Parlays are perfect for bettors who want to take on higher risk for higher rewards and are looking to bet on multiple events at once.

5. Live Betting (In-Play)


Live betting, also known as in-play betting, allows you to place bets while the event is ongoing. Unlike traditional pre-match betting, live betting lets you wager on changing odds during the course of the game. For example, you can bet on who will score the next goal in a soccer match, or whether a basketball team will cover the spread during the fourth quarter.

JILIBET’s live betting feature is particularly exciting because it adds an extra level of engagement to sports events. Bettors can make decisions based on the real-time action and momentum of the game, which makes live betting both challenging and thrilling.

6. Futures Bets


A futures bet is a long-term bet on an event that will occur at a later date. For example, you might place a futures bet on the winner of the Super Bowl at the start of the NFL season or the Premier League champion at the beginning of a football season. Futures bets often offer higher odds because they are based on outcomes that are harder to predict over a longer period of time.

While futures bets come with inherent uncertainty, they can also provide a rewarding experience, especially if you correctly predict a long-term outcome.

7. Prop Bets (Proposition Bets)


Proposition bets, or prop bets, are wagers on specific events or occurrences within a game, unrelated to the final outcome. These can range from simple bets like “Will a player score a touchdown?” in football, to more complex wagers like “How many corners will be taken in a soccer match?” or “Which team will commit the first foul?”

Props are fun for bettors who want to get into the details of a game, and they often provide more variety than standard betting options.
